Poultry production up but prices remain strong
LITITZ The egg industry once
again is facing an adjustment
problem as production and
marketing costs continue their
upward trend and egg production
continues to equal year earlier
levels.
The big question is “How many
eggs will consumers be willing to
buy at prices high enough to return
a profit to producers and
marketers’”
It will likely be less than what
was produced and marketed a year
earlier. However, the quantity that
can be sold profitably will depend
on many factors, including prices
of other food items and changes in

February 1980 was the first
month since August 1977 that the
number of layers in the United
States was below the same month a
year earlier. In March 1980 there
were about one percent fewer
layers on farms than a year
earlier. The reduced number of
layers on farms each month as
compared with a year earlier
continued to be about one percent
less through July.
In September 1980, the average
number of layers on farms was
about 0.2 percent more than a year
earlier On January 1, 1981 there

The cutback m number of layers
in the spring occurred after prices
were well below the average costs
of producing eggs. Following the
adverse weather in June and July,
which curtailed production and
pushed blend egg prices well above
production costs, the industry
increased the proportion of layers
in the nation’s laying flock which
had been force molted
Also, other layers were ap
parently held in production for
longer intervals than was planned
before prices advanced sharply

This resulted in an increase in the
number of layers on farms in
September -and subsequent
months.
A factor adding to the weakness
of egg prices last spring was the
cutback in quantity of eggs used
for hatching of broiler chicks.
Demand for eggs for hatching
meat type clucks has been strong.
Hatchabillty has been down. This
increases the number of eggs
needed per 100 broiler chicks
hatched and it requires an in
creased percent of the available
supply of hatching eggs.

Long periods of unfavorable
broiler prices will likely result in
marketing hens at earlier ages
than planned originally.
As the broiler industry continues
to expand, an increasing
proportion of the nation’s total egg
production is used for production
of broiler chicks. In December 1980
and 9 3 percent of total egg
production was used for hatching
chicks
